How they compare
Montenegro currently reports 20,431 number against 19,079 number in Sao Tome and Principe, a difference of 1,352 number.
That makes Montenegro's figure about 1.1 times Sao Tome and Principe's.
Across all 12 years both countries report, Montenegro has been ahead every year.
Montenegro ranks 167th and Sao Tome and Principe ranks 170th of 202 countries.
Montenegro has averaged higher in every one of the 2 decades both report.
